Brick Hardscaping in Denver, CO
Brick hardscaping services encompass a range of projects that en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of outdoor properties using brick materials. Typical projects include constructing walkways, patios, retaining walls, fire pits, and outdoor dining areas. Homeowners often seek these services to create durable, low-maintenance surfaces and features that complement their landscape design. Before requesting brick hardscaping work, property owners should consider factors such as the desired purpose of the space, style preferences, the extent of excavation or site preparation needed, and any specific design ideas or patterns they envision.
Understanding the scope of brick hardscaping projects also involves knowing about the materials available, including different types of brick and mortar, as well as the importance of proper installation techniques for longevity and stability. Property owners usually want to clarify the planning process, including how the project will integrate with existing landscaping, drainage considerations, and any permits or regulations that may apply. Having clear expectations about the project’s design, materials, and overall maintenance can help ensure a smooth and satisfying outdoor improvement.

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ders to enhance durability and aesthetic appeal.
How does brick hardscaping improve property value? Well-designed brick features add curb appeal and structural functionality, which can increase overall property value.
What maintenance is required for brick hardscaping? Regular cleaning and occasional repointing help maintain the appearance and integrity of brick installations.
Can brick hardscaping be customized to match existing landscapes? Yes, brick styles, colors, and patterns can be tailored to complement existing outdoor designs and personal preferences.
